  [Impact]
  The new Network manager has some extra options and this breaks the usage of (probably) any type of VPN. No new connection can be created or existing ones edited.
  
  It fails with the message: «connection.gateway-ping-timeout: can not set
  property: value "18454592" of type 'guint' is invalid or out of range
  for property 'gateway-ping-timeout' of type 'guint'»
  
  [Testcase]
+ Before patch:
+   * Install Kubuntu 16.04
+   * Connect to a network (connection being done automatically)
+   * Create a new VPN connection
+     * For example PPTP
+     * Type in gateway any string longer than one character
+     * Click ok
+     * Receive notification error «connection.gateway-ping-timeout: can not set property: value "18454592" of type 'guint' is invalid or out of range for property 'gateway-ping-timeout' of type 'guint'»
+     * notice connection is not created
+   * Create a new connection (wireless or wired)
+     * Change the IP to manual
+     * Save
+     * Receive noification error «same as above»
+     * Notice connection is not created
+   * Import a VPN connection
+     * Save
+     * Receive notification error «same as above»
+     * Notice connection is not created
+ 
+ After the patch:
+     Do all of the above, and the connection gets created every time. Test each connection and they work.
  
  [Fix]
  In KDE bug https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=362141 for this issue a fix is commited. This is released in KDE Frameworks 5.21.  The patch can be cherry picked and applied to networkmanager-qt 5.18.
